The RKZ33BKGP1Q is a Zener diode manufactured by Renesas Electronics America, designed for voltage regulation and transient voltage suppression in electronic circuits. It offers a stable reference voltage and protects sensitive components from overvoltage damage. Its controlled breakdown voltage characteristic ensures reliable operation in various applications.

Additional Details
The RKZ33BKGP1Q Zener diode is designed for applications where precise voltage regulation and overvoltage protection are crucial. Its ability to maintain a constant voltage across its terminals when the reverse voltage exceeds its Zener voltage makes it an ideal component for protecting sensitive electronic devices from damage. This component's small size allows it to be used in compact electronic designs where board space is at a premium.
